Hi guys, about to change the wires and plugs on the 03 SS. Just curious as to what size gap I should be going with. I'm going to go with MSD wires and NGK TR5 V-Power plugs. I have read anywhere from .30 - .60 as for a gap. Which one should I go with and why? What will a smaller gap help where a wider gap fails and vice versa. Go with the Tr-55's they are pre-gapped at .050 as compared to the TR-5's at around .039. Check the gap on them anyways. I don't know your mods but a .050-.055 gap on a bolt on motor should be good to go. If you go with iridium plugs do not try to gap them. You can carefully check the gap but don't try to gap them.

I use between 55 to 60. Normally .055 is what I go with. If you have a closer gap, the burn on the plug itself might not be as clean, and can lead to a misfire.
